Men’s Weekend Retreat at Malvern Retreat House

The annual Nativity BVM Retreat, a traditional retreat for men, will take place at the Malvern Retreat House on the weekend of September 8-10. This is an ideal way to wind down summer, kick off fall and get closer to yourself and to God. The theme for the weekend is Finding Peace, Healing and Hope in Today’s World. The retreat director for the weekend is Fr. Charles Zlock, pastor of St. Raymond of Penafort Parish in Mt. Airy and will feature conversations with Kevin Reilly, former Eagles and Wildcats standout, and three-time Grammy award nominee Marty Rotella. Visit https://www.malvernretreat.com/events/nativity-bvm-2023/ to register or call Jack Warnock for more information at 610-564-8456.

8th Annual Padre Pio Festival

Saint Bede the Venerable Church in Holland, PA welcomes all to a festival to honor St. Pio of Pietrelcina, better known as Padre Pio, on Saturday and Sunday, Sept. 16 and 17. The two-day event begins with Saturday’s All-American Picnic Buffet (tickets will be sold at the event). The highlight will be a 5:30 PM Vigil Mass, followed by blessings with holy relics of Padre Pio. The Sunday 12:30 PM Solemn Mass will be celebrated by Archbishop Nelson Perez. The Mass is followed by a street procession, healing service with confessions and veneration of holy relics. Both days there will be specialty food and craft vendors, amusements for children, and live musical entertainment. Plenty of free parking will be available, and pilgrim buses are welcome. For more information, go online to padrepiofestivalhollandpa.com, or call the St. Bede parish office at 215-357-5720.
